// overview

Browserbase is a cloud browser-agent infrastructure platform for letting AI agents and automations search, fetch, browse, log in, extract data, and act on the web at scale.

Best for: Engineering-led GTM, RevOps, data, and AI-agent teams that need reliable browser automation for prospect research, enrichment, competitive monitoring, account intelligence, and workflows beyond static APIs.

// pricing

Free tier · generosity 0/5
Includes: Runtime included
Limits: 3 concurrent browsers · 1 browser hour · 1,000 Search calls · 1,000 Fetch calls · 15 minutes /session · 7 days data retention · $5 in tokens
Developer$20/mo
  • 25 concurrent browsers
  • 100 browser hours then $0.12/browser hr
  • 1,000 Search calls then $7/1k calls
  • 1,000 Fetch calls then $1/1k calls
  • $4/1k calls with proxies
  • 1 GB of proxies then $12/GB
  • 7 days data retention
  • Model Gateway Market Price: Pay as you go
  • Auto captcha solving
Startup$99/mo
  • 100 concurrent browsers
  • 500 browser hours then $0.10/browser hr
  • 1,000 Search calls then $7/1k calls
  • 10,000 Fetch calls then $1/1k calls
  • $4/1k calls with proxies
  • 5 GB of proxies then $10/GB
  • 30 days data retention
  • Model Gateway Market Price: Pay as you go
  • Auto captcha solving
ScaleCustom
  • 250+ concurrent browsers
  • 500+ browser hours usage-based
  • 10,000+ Search calls usage-based
  • 10,000+ Fetch calls usage-based
  • 5+ GB of proxies usage-based
  • 30+ days data retention
  • Model Gateway Market Price: Pay as you go
  • Verified Agents + Captcha solving
  • Enterprise HIPAA (BAA) & DPA
  • SSO available

// features

  • API-controlled cloud Chromium browser sessions
  • Search API for agent-oriented web search
  • Fetch API returning HTML, markdown, or structured JSON
  • Stagehand SDK for natural-language browser actions and extraction
  • Playwright, Puppeteer, Selenium, and CDP-compatible browser control
  • Persistent sessions, cookies, uploads, downloads, and Chrome extensions
  • Managed residential/datacenter proxies and custom proxy support
  • Built-in CAPTCHA solving and Agent Identity on paid tiers
  • Live View, session replay, logs, network traces, and console output
  • Browserbase Functions runtime to run agent code near the browser

pros

  • Purpose-built for production browser agents rather than simple scraping only
  • Useful for GTM workflows that need live, dynamic, authenticated web access
  • Strong observability and debugging with live view and session recordings
  • Generous concurrency on paid plans compared with self-hosting browser fleets

cons

  • Usage-based overages for browser hours, Search/Fetch/Extract, proxies, and models can make spend variable
  • Free plan is limited to 1 browser hour and lacks CAPTCHA solving
  • Requires developer/API implementation for most Browserbase workflows unless using Director
  • Advanced stealth, verified agents, SSO, HIPAA/BAA, and custom controls require Scale/enterprise engagement
